  • Patent number: 8704650
    Abstract: To test whether a trailer is coupled to a tractor when the tractor ignition switch is off, a test switch in the trailer connects a high-impedance power source in a trailer to a line carrying energy from the tractor ignition switch to the trailer's electrical load, and measures the voltage at the line. A high voltage indicates a connection only to the electrical load in the trailer and thus a decouple. A low voltage indicates a measurement of the electrical loads in both trailer and tractor and hence a coupling.

  • Publication number: 20130261996
    Abstract: A method and apparatus are provided for determining a level of fuel in a tank, comprising determining a dielectric constant of fuel in a tank; measuring a capacitance of an unknown depth of the fuel in the tank; and calculating the depth using the dielectric constant and the capacitance. Embodiments of the apparatus utilize a capacitor plate submerged in the fuel to determine the dielectric constant of the fuel, and then use a plate of a separate capacitor to determine the fuel level, once the dielectric constant is known.
